¿Cuál es la diferencia entre SQL y SQLite?

Preguntado por: Aaron Noriega Tercero  |  Última actualización: 4 de abril de 2022
Puntuación: 4.8/5 (27 valoraciones)

Sqlite es un sistema de gestión de base de datos relacional incorporable. SQL es el lenguaje de consulta. Sqlite es un sistema de gestión de base de datos relacional incorporable. A diferencia de otras bases de datos (como SQL Server y MySQL), SQLite no admite procedimientos almacenados.

¿Qué diferencia a SQLite de otras bases de datos SQL?

Diferencias arquitectónicas entre MySQL y SQLite

SQLite es una base de datos sin servidor y es independiente. Esto también se conoce como una base de datos integrada, lo que significa que el motor de base de datos se ejecuta como parte de la aplicación. Por otro lado, MySQL requiere un servidor para ejecutarse.

¿Cuándo se debe usar SQLite?

Por tanto se recomienda utilizar SQLite cuando desarrollamos una aplicación en la que necesitemos usar Internet para consultar los datos de la app y no tenemos algunas veces una buena señal de cobertura, con SQLite podemos usar los valores almacenados en la caché de la base de datos.

¿Cuál es mejor MySQL o SQLite?

Acceso múltiple y escalabilidad: SQLite vs MySQL

SQLite es adecuado para bases de datos más pequeñas. A medida que la base de datos crece, el requisito de memoria también aumenta al usar SQLite. ... Por el contrario, MySQL es fácilmente escalable y puede manejar una base de datos más grande con menos esfuerzo.

¿Qué se necesita para usar SQLite?

El procedimiento recomendado para crear una nueva base de datos SQLite es, de forma esquemática:
  1. crer una clase que extienda de SQLiteOpenHelper.
  2. sobreescribir en ella el método onCreate() , donde se ejecutará un comando de SQLite para crear las tablas de la base de datos.

SQLite - Definición, Características, Funciones y Ventajas

42 preguntas relacionadas encontradas

¿Cómo se crea una base de datos en SQLite?

Podemos crear una base de datos SQLite con la utilidad sqlite3 desde la línea de comandos. Por ejemplo, para crear una base de datos con el nombre agenda. db ejecutaremos el siguiente comando. Este comando creará un archivo donde se almacenará toda la información de nuestra base de datos.

¿Qué es SQLite y cómo se conecta a una base de datos local?

Sucede que SQLite nos ofrece también la posibilidad de crear bases de datos relacionales. Puedes imaginar a SQLite como un MySQL pequeño, o una simplificación de los antes mencionados. ... Esta app se conecta con una API, que le permite consumir y guardar datos.

¿Qué es SQLite ventajas y desventajas?

Aplicaciones de SQLite

Cuando se requiere una base de datos integrada dentro de una aplicación. SQLite es una excelente opción por su facilidad de configuración. El inconveniente es que no escala a bases de datos demasiado grandes (en el orden de los terabytes).

¿Qué motor de base de datos es más rápido?

Cassandra es posiblemente la base de datos más rápida que existe cuando se trata de manejar cargas de escritura pesadas. Escalabilidad lineal. Es decir, puede seguir agregando tantos nodos a un clúster como desee, y habrá un aumento cero en la complejidad o fragilidad del clúster.

¿Qué empresas utilizan SQLite?

No obstante muchas empresas potentes lo utilizan para sus aplicaciones de escritorio:
  • Adobe Photoshop Elements.
  • Mozilla Firefox.
  • Openoffice.org.
  • Skype.
  • Opera.
  • The New Yorker.
  • XBMC (XBox Media Center)
  • … Etc.

¿Cuántos usuarios soporta SQLite?

Los Límites de SQLite.

El número máximo de columnas por defecto es 2000 (configurable a 32767) aunque un buen diseño por muy complejo que sea se estima que no debe superar las 100.

¿Cómo conectarse a SQLite?

  1. import sqlite3.
  2. conn = sqlite3. connect('/home/usuario/data.sqlite')
  3. cur = conn. cursor()
  4. cur. execute('SELECT * FROM usuarios')
  5. for row in cur:
  6. //Realizo las operaciones oportunas.
  7. cur. close()

¿Qué es un archivo SQLite?

¿Qué es el archivo SQLITE? Los archivos almacenados en el formato SQLITE son archivos de base de datos creados con las bibliotecas SQLite, un sistema para capturar y administrar bases de datos. Los datos almacenados en archivos SQLITE se colocan en tablas.

¿Qué es PostgreSQL ventajas y desventajas?

PostgreSQL es un software libre y de código abierto que puede ser utilizado en proyectos profesionales sin necesidad de realizar un desembolso económico. MVCC. Este gestor de bases de datos posee un control de concurrencias multiversión, un sistema que ofrece grandes ventajas de rendimiento. Consultas no relacionales.

¿Cómo descargar SQLite?

Para instalar sqlite3 en Windows necesitas, en primer lugar, dirigirte al sitio web https://www.sqlite.org/download.html ahí te dirigirás a la sección Precompiled Binaries for Windows, en la que encontrarás los binarios para Windows, de ahí tienes que descargar los archivos: sqlite-tools. sqlite-dll.

¿Cuál es la base de datos más fácil de usar?

Oracle, DB2 o SQL Server son algunas de las bases de datos más utilizadas hoy en día. Los tipos de bases de datos relacionales como Oracle, DB2 de IBM y SQL Server e incluso Microsoft Access, forman la columna vertebral para el almacenamiento de datos y la gestión en la mayoría de organizaciones de hoy en día.

¿Cuál es el mejor sistema de base de datos?

MySQL es el líder en el espacio de bases de datos relacionales según la firma de investigación G2 Crowd.

¿Cuál es la base de datos más potente?

SQL Server es el sistema de bases de datos más completo y potente, y resulta ideal para los programadores especializados en productos Microsoft: ASP, Visual Basic, modelos de objetos componentes, etc. ... Más información sobre bases de datos MS SQL Server.

¿Cuáles son las ventajas y desventajas de los gestores de base de datos?

Sistema gestor de base de datos: resumen de ventajas e inconvenientes
  • Gestión fácil de grandes conjuntos de datos.
  • Acceso sencillo y eficaz a los datos almacenados.
  • Gran flexibilidad.
  • Integridad y consistencia de los datos.
  • Control de acceso del usuario (seguridad y protección de datos)
  • Alta disponibilidad.

¿Qué es MongoDB ventajas y desventajas?

Ventajas de MongoDB

Posee una documentación muy buena, muy amplia y detallada en comparación con otras bases de datos NoSQL. Si eres desarrollador de aplicaciones utilizando este lenguaje, podrás utilizar toda la potencia de sus funciones y operadores en MongoDB.

¿Cómo se vincula la app de Java con SQLite?

Antes de instalar, lo que necesitaremos será ahora el driver JDBC para poder conectar Java con SQLite, este lo podremos obtener de la siguiente página, del cual descargarán el archivo de nombre: sqlite-jdbc-3.7.15-M1. jar, una vez que esté a la mano, podremos comenzar.

¿Dónde se guarda la base de datos SQLite en Android?

Las bases de datos se almacenan como archivos SQLite en / data / data / PACKAGE / databases / DATABASEFILE donde: PACKAGE es el paquete declarado en el archivo AndroidManifest.

¿Cómo ver la base de datos SQLite en Android Studio?

Hay algunos pasos para ver las tablas en una base de datos SQLite:
  1. Enumere las tablas en su base de datos: .tables.
  2. Enumere cómo se ve la tabla: .schema tablename.
  3. Imprima toda la tabla: SELECT * FROM tablename;
  4. Enumere todos los comandos de comandos SQLite disponibles: .help.

¿Cómo es el formato de archivos de SQLite?

SQLITE3 es una extensión de archivo comúnmente asociada con los archivos SQLite 3 Database Format. El formato SQLite 3 Database Format fue desarrollado por SQLite. Los archivos SQLITE3 son compatibles con las aplicaciones de software disponibles para dispositivos que ejecutan Linux, Mac OS, Windows.

¿Cuánto cuesta SQLite?

SQLite ofrece los siguientes planes de precios: A partir de: USD 2,000.00/una vez. Prueba gratis: No disponible.

Articolo precedente
¿Cuáles son los honorarios de un abogado en un divorcio?
Articolo successivo
¿Qué es el realismo literario ejemplos?